Summary of IELTS in Dubai
The IELTS exam in Dubai is available through a number of authorized test centers, all offering a favorable environment for candidates to show their English language capabilities. The exam is divided into four sections: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each section is evaluated on a band scale of 0 to 9, with 9 being the highest.
Table 1: IELTS Test Format
Section
Period
Number of Questions
Description
Listening
30 mins
40
Four areas with different question types
Reading
60 minutes
40
Three sections with various texts
Writing
60 mins
2 tasks
Task 1 (150 words) and Task 2 (250 words)
Speaking
11-14 mins
3 parts
Face-to-face interview with an examiner

Registration Process
Signing up for the IELTS exam in Dubai is a straightforward process. Candidates must follow particular steps:
- Select the Test Type: Choose in between IELTS Academic or IELTS General Training, based on your requirements.
- Choose a Test Center: Select your favored test center from the list above.
- Register Online: Visit the official website of the chosen test center to complete the registration kind.
- Pay the Fees: The IELTS exam fee in Dubai normally ranges from AED 1,000 to AED 1,300. Payment can be made online during the registration procedure.
- Book a Test Date: Choose a hassle-free date from the offered choices.

Understanding the Assessment Criteria
Each section of the IELTS exam is assessed based on particular criteria. Understanding these can greatly help prospects in preparing effectively:
Listening and Reading
- Precision: Ability to listen and read for detail.
- Understanding: Comprehension of the main points and supporting information.
Writing
- Job Response: Addressing the task requirements.
- Coherence and Cohesion: Logical company and connection of ideas.
- Lexical Resource: Range and accuracy of vocabulary.
- Grammatical Range and Accuracy: Correct grammar usage.
Speaking
- Fluency and Coherence: Ability to speak at length on a given subject.
- Lexical Resource and Grammatical Range: Use of a wide range of vocabulary and grammatical structures.
- Pronunciation: Clarity of speech and accent.
Common FAQs about the IELTS Exam in Dubai
Q1: How frequently is the IELTS exam carried out in Dubai?
A1: The IELTS exam is conducted several times weekly throughout various test centers in Dubai. Prospects can examine specific dates on the test center's site.
Q2: What is the validity of the IELTS score?
A2: IELTS scores stand for two years from the date of the exam.
Q3: Can I change my test date after registration?
A3: Yes, prospects can reschedule their test date, but this undergoes a charge and needs to be done a minimum of five weeks prior to the test.
Q4: What identification is required on test day?
A4: Candidates should provide a legitimate passport or nationwide ID that matches the details used during registration.
Q5: Are there any lodgings for test-takers with special requirements?
A5: Yes, test centers in Dubai offer lodgings for candidates with unique requirements. It is recommended to get in touch with the test center beforehand to arrange these services.
